[Pkg-auth-maintainers] Bug#1000187: yubikey-manager: Exception when trying to add an oath account

Tobias Bengfort tobias.bengfort at posteo.de
Fri Nov 19 11:51:46 GMT 2021


Package: yubikey-manager
Version: 4.0.0~a1-4
Severity: grave
Justification: renders package unusable

Dear Maintainer,

   $ ykman oath accounts add foo bar

always results in

   AttributeError: 'OATH_TYPE' object has no attribute 'upper'

The only way to prevent this is to explicitly pass both oath type and
algorithm:

   $ ykman oath accounts -o TOTP -a SHA1 add foo bar


-- System Information:
Debian Release: 11.1
  APT prefers stable-security
  APT policy: (500, 'stable-security'), (500, 'stable'), (420, 'testing')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 5.10.0-9-amd64 (SMP w/4 CPU threads)
Kernel taint flags: TAINT_WARN
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8), LANGUAGE not set
Shell: /bin/sh linked to /usr/b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ages yubikey-manager depends on:
ii  pcscd                 1.9.1-1
ii  python3               3.9.2-3
ii  python3-click         7.1.2-1
ii  python3-cryptography  3.3.2-1
ii  python3-fido2         0.9.1-1
ii  python3-ykman         4.0.0~a1-4

yubikey-manager recommends no packages.

yubikey-manager suggests no packages.

-- no debconf information



More information about the Pkg-auth-maintainers mailing list